Câu hỏi Cài đặt sạch Ubuntu 14.04 - Màn hình chuyển sang màu đen sau khi đăng nhập, nhưng chuột hoạt động


Disclaimer có rất nhiều câu hỏi về chủ đề này và không ai trong số họ áp dụng cho tình hình của tôi.

Lưu ý những điều dưới đây:

  1. Hệ thống trước đó đã chạy Ubuntu 12.04 Desktop 32bit mà không có vấn đề gì.
  2. Đây là một cài đặt sạch, không phải là bản nâng cấp. Cài đặt trước đã bị ghi đè.
  3. Màn hình màu đen xuất hiện sau khi đăng nhập, không phải trong khi khởi động.
  4. Màn hình đen xuất hiện bất kể trình điều khiển video, mặc định (nouveau) hoặc nvidia
  5. Nó không phải là lẻ tẻ, nó xảy ra mọi lúc.
  6. Nó không phải là kết quả của việc trở về từ giấc ngủ hoặc đình chỉ.

Tôi đã cài đặt Ubuntu 14.04 Desktop 32bit sạch (ubuntu-14.04-desktop-i386.iso) bằng liveUSB. Quá trình cài đặt hoàn tất thành công, hệ thống khởi động lại và tôi đăng nhập. Sau khi đăng nhập: màn hình (với nền có thể nhìn thấy) nhấp nháy và cuối cùng đi màu đen (không có nền, không có Unity Panel, không có Unity Launcher), và tôi có thể di chuyển chuột về màn hình.

Chỉ trong trường hợp có bản cập nhật giải quyết vấn đề này, tôi chuyển sang tty1 (Ctrl + Alt + F1) và nhập:

sudo apt-get update
sudo apt-get dist-upgrade

Khởi động lại và điều tương tự sau khi đăng nhập: màn hình nhấp nháy và cuối cùng chuyển sang màu đen và tôi có thể di chuyển chuột về màn hình.

Máy có card đồ họa nvidia, card màn hình GeForce FX 5700LE.

lspci | grep VGA

01:00.0 VGA compatible controller: NVIDIA Corporation NV36 [GeForce FX 5700LE] (rec a1)

Vì vậy, tôi cài đặt các trình điều khiển nvidia 173:

sudo apt-get install nvidia-173

Khởi động lại và bây giờ sau khi đăng nhập: màn hình chuyển sang màu đen và tôi có thể di chuyển chuột về màn hình.

Có một số bài đăng về màn hình đen Ubuntu 14.04 sau khi đăng nhập, tuy nhiên chúng dường như là kết quả của việc nâng cấp từ phiên bản Ubuntu trước và không phải là cài đặt sạch. Bất kể điều đó tôi mệt mỏi giải pháp cho vấn đề đó là để thanh lọc các trình điều khiển nvidia hiện có thông qua sudo apt-get remove --purge nvidia* . Không ngạc nhiên của tôi sau khi khởi động lại và đăng nhập, tôi thấy hành vi ban đầu: màn hình nhấp nháy và cuối cùng trở thành màu đen, và tôi có thể di chuyển chuột về màn hình.

Tôi cũng đã cố gắng để khởi động Ubuntu trong chế độ phục hồi bằng cách sử dụng failsafeX, tôi thấy một popup nói rằng, "Hệ thống đang chạy ở chế độ đồ họa thấp". Không có con chuột nào hiển thị. Tôi nhấn tab và nhập. Màn hình tiếp theo nói, "Bạn muốn làm gì?" và "Chạy ở chế độ đồ họa thấp chỉ cho một phiên" được chọn. Tôi nhấn tab hai lần, đánh dấu "OK" và nhấn enter. Màn hình tiếp theo nói, "Chờ một phút trong khi màn hình khởi động lại ...". Tôi nhấn enter. Tôi thấy một màn hình màu đen sáng không có chuột.

Tôi đọc rằng đây có thể là một vấn đề khác vì nó xảy ra * sau khi * nhập mật khẩu của bạn trên trang đăng nhập.


4
2018-05-23 04:22


gốc




Các câu trả lời:


Hóa ra sự thống nhất không hỗ trợ thẻ video của tôi. Dường như có một số thẻ NVIDIA cũ hơn mà người ta sẽ nghĩ sẽ làm việc với sự thống nhất, nhưng không phải vì chúng bị liệt vào danh sách đen. Để biết thêm thông tin về điều này được tìm thấy đây.

Tôi đã kiểm tra thẻ video của mình với sự thống nhất:

/usr/lib/nux/unity_support_test -p

trả lại:

OpenGL vendor string:   NVIDIA Corporation
OpenGL renderer string: GeForce FX 5700LE/AGP/SSE2
OpenGL version string:  2.1.2 NVIDIA 173.14.39

Not software rendered:    yes
Not blacklisted:          no
GLX fbconfig:             yes
GLX texture from pixmap:  yes
GL npot or rect textures: yes
GL vertex program:        yes
GL fragment program:      yes
GL vertex buffer object:  yes
GL framebuffer object:    yes
GL version is 1.4+:       yes

Unity 3D supported:       no

Tôi lặp lại điều này với cả nouveau hoặc nvidia-173, sự thống nhất cũng không được hỗ trợ.

Tôi tìm thấy công việc sau đây xung quanh:


GNOME

Tôi đã có thể chạy Ubuntu 14.04 với gnome thay vì đoàn kết.

@tty (Ctrl + Alt + F1):

sudo apt-get update
sudo apt-get install gnome-session-flashback

khởi động lại

lời nhắc @login:

  1. Nhấp vào hình ảnh ở phía trên bên phải của tên
  2. Chọn: GNOME Flashback (Metacity)

Lubuntu hoặc Xubuntu

Một giải pháp thay thế cho Unity và GNOME là Lubuntu hoặc là Xubuntu.

Chỉ cần cho các hồ sơ, tôi đã không thử một trong những kể từ khi tôi đã có thể chạy Ubuntu với gnome.


Unity-2d trên Ubuntu 14.04?

Trong Ubuntu 12.04, tôi nhớ chạy Unity-2d vì tôi không thể chạy được sự thống nhất. Trong Ubuntu 12.04, chúng ta có thể chọn Unity-2d tại màn hình đăng nhập tương tự như cách mà gnome được chọn trong văn bản ở trên.

Tôi đã có thể cài đặt unity-2d @ a tty: sudo apt-get install unity-2d Tuy nhiên, tôi đã không thể chuyển từ sự thống nhất thành unity-2d. Tôi đọc một số nơi mà sự thống nhất mặc định là thống nhất-2d khi nó không thể chạy, rõ ràng là nó không hoạt động trong trường hợp của tôi.


4
2018-05-23 04:22



unity-2d chỉ là một gói giả trong Ubuntu 14.04 trỏ đến thường xuyên ("3D") unity gói. Xem ví dụ askubuntu.com/questions/487177/… - Bernhard Reiter
Gnome Flashback là một lựa chọn tốt. Kubuntu sẽ là một người khác, vui vẻ sử dụng nó trên máy tính "chính" của tôi. Tôi chỉ không hiểu tại sao Ubuntu cài đặt Unity trên một máy tính với một card đồ họa danh sách đen, để lại cho người dùng với một màn hình màu đen và thậm chí không phải là một cảnh báo. - Torsten Römer


Tôi đã phải đối mặt với cùng một vấn đề trong xps của tôi nhưng không ai trong số này hoạt động. Vì vậy, đối với một công việc xung quanh tôi đã tạo một người dùng khác với đặc quyền root và bây giờ tôi có thể đăng nhập bằng tài khoản người dùng đó và truy cập tất cả các ứng dụng và tệp của tôi.


0
2018-06-03 11:50



Chào mừng bạn đến với Hỏi Ubuntu! Tôi khuyên bạn nên chỉnh sửaing câu trả lời này để mở rộng nó với các chi tiết cụ thể về cách thực hiện điều này. (Xem thêm Làm cách nào để viết câu trả lời hay? để được tư vấn chung về những loại câu trả lời nào được coi là có giá trị nhất trên Ask Ubuntu.) - David Foerster
Giải pháp của bạn cho rằng đây là vấn đề với cấu hình đồ họa của hồ sơ người dùng của bạn. Thay vì tạo người dùng mới, bạn có thể đặt lại cấu hình có liên quan (sau khi sao lưu). - David Foerster
Đó có thể là một cách có thể nhưng tôi không có nhiều thời gian để sao lưu tất cả dữ liệu của mình. Vì vậy, tôi vừa tạo một người dùng khác để có giải pháp nhanh chóng. - sankycse
Tôi có nghĩa là sao lưu các tập tin cấu hình (nên được ít hơn 1 MB) ... không phải là toàn bộ hồ sơ người dùng hoặc thậm chí tất cả các dữ liệu cá nhân. - David Foerster